Output d62cb62758634d9110957615aba53c5a5ced78fd293c7048dcb92eead16f5d3e:1

value
59044
script pubkey
OP_0 OP_PUSHBYTES_20 d8579e2aa443841d8808566278a2d4e31e669b61
address
bc1qmpteu24ygwzpmzqg2e383gk5uv0xdxmpymg2rt
transaction
d62cb62758634d9110957615aba53c5a5ced78fd293c7048dcb92eead16f5d3e
spent
true